Vulnerability in Red Hat Amq Broker 7

CVE-2026-93492

A flaw was found in Netty's HTTP/2 HpackEncoder. A remote attacker can exploit this by sending HTTP/2 SETTINGS frames with a very large MAX_HEADER_TABLE_SIZE. This causes the HpackEncoder to store an excessive number of unique headers, leading to increased CPU usage and memory consumption, ultimately resulting in a Denial of Service (DoS).

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 5.3 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:L.
